Ordinals
beta
Sat 1503551833830666
decimal
391420.1833830666
degree
0°181420′316″1833830666‴
percentile
71.59770645164637%
name
devdsexwpqt
cycle
0
epoch
1
period
194
block
391420
offset
1833830666
timestamp
2016-01-02 18:10:12 UTC
rarity
common
prev
next